African Revolution- Album Overview
Tiken Jah Fakoly, the renowned Ivorian reggae artist, made a triumphant return with his album "African Revolution," released in 2019. This album, a powerful blend of reggae and African rhythms, was launched under the renowned label, Wrasse Records. Known for his politically charged lyrics and dedication to social justice, Fakoly has always used his music as a platform for activism, and "African Revolution" is no exception. The album was recorded in various locations, including his home country of Côte d'Ivoire, and features collaborations with a range of talented musicians.
The album's lead single, "Fémi," showcases Fakoly's unique style, combining traditional African sounds with contemporary reggae. Throughout the album, Fakoly addresses pressing issues such as poverty, corruption, and the need for unity among African nations. His lyrics resonate deeply with listeners, drawing from his experiences and the socio-political landscape of Africa. The production quality is high, with a rich instrumentation that includes brass sections and traditional African percussion, enhancing the overall listening experience. "African Revolution" not only marks a significant addition to Fakoly's discography but also serves as a rallying cry for African pride and resilience, cementing his role as a voice for the voiceless on the continent.
Review
"African Revolution" excels in its ability to fuse traditional African musical elements with reggae, creating a sound that is both refreshing and familiar. Tiken Jah Fakoly's vocal delivery remains as passionate as ever, conveying a sense of urgency and hope. The album's lyrical content is deeply introspective, encouraging listeners to reflect on their identity and the socio-political challenges facing Africa today. Notably, tracks such as "Fémi" and "African Revolution" stand out for their infectious melodies and poignant messages. The instrumentation is rich and varied, with a mix of guitars, horns, and percussive elements that create an engaging soundscape.
Fakoly's artistic vision shines through as he blends personal narratives with broader themes of unity and empowerment. However, while the album is largely successful, it occasionally falls into familiar tropes of the genre, which may not resonate with every listener. Nevertheless, the overall execution of the album reflects Fakoly's commitment to his craft and his unwavering belief in the power of music to inspire change.
